One position they have says the following "The hourly rate for the position you are applying for is $8.70 per hour plus performance based incentives of up to $250 per month." Thats for their customer service client.

The second position that I was offered says "The hourly rate for the position you are applying for is $8.50 per hour + $1.50 per talk time hour." Thats for their technical support client. I listened to a sample technical support call and YES it might be frustrating to some while EASY for someone else. The way I see it, it just depends on your tolerance level of that same type of call coming through over and over and over again. Press this, now press that, unplug this, now plug this in. If you've been in customer service before you know as well as I know that it might be easy for one customer to comprehend while its like teaching GREEK and HEBREW at the same time to someone else. Its really just going to depend. I let my roomate listen to the call and he took the earphones out and did not want to hear anymore of it because it reminded him too much of his current job. Troubleshooting!

I am still in the interview process so I wont be much help answering any other questions unless hired HOWEVER the above information is what the email stated for what they are currently looking to pay people (current as of 01/05/2010)
